Removing a PCIe adapter from the 9008-22L, 9009-22A, or 9223-22H system
To remove a PCIe adapter from the system, complete the steps in this procedure.
Procedure
1. Ensure that you have the electrostatic discharge (ESD) wrist strap on and that the ESD clip is plugged
into a ground jack or connected to an unpainted metal surface. If not, do so now.
2. To set the adapter latch (A) at the target slot into the open position, rotate the latch (A) on the rear of
the system as shown.
